Transaction e5f2521103bc2f010a105ed10a36a182e8f5ce2fbec4aa77ab37cec525e12ff3

1 Input
1 Outputs
  • e5f2521103bc2f010a105ed10a36a182e8f5ce2fbec4aa77ab37cec525e12ff3:0
  • value  74521
    address  34hW3ZUxJgvGmeynG6AL2ZHzoRgkXeNEEV